Agave care requirements

These care conditions are most relevant to mushy stems in Agave. Check each one as a potential cause.

water_drop
Water
Rarely — drought tolerant in the extreme.
compost
Soil
Sharply draining, sandy or gravelly soil.
thermometer
Temperature
Hardy to -10°C (14°F) when dry.

Symptoms to look for in Agave

  • fiber_manual_recordSoft, water-soaked stems
  • fiber_manual_recordStem collapsing at base
help

Common causes in Agave

  • fiber_manual_recordOverwatering
  • fiber_manual_recordRoot rot
  • fiber_manual_recordStem rot disease
  • fiber_manual_recordCold damage
troubleshoot

How to diagnose mushy stems in Agave

Press gently on stems. Healthy stems are firm. Mushy stems indicate rot.

healing

How to treat mushy stems in Agave

Trim affected stems. Allow soil to dry. Repot with fresh compost.

shield

Preventing mushy stems in Agave

Water sparingly. Never let plants sit in water. Use well-draining soil.
